如下图, 单链表中存在环: 怎么判断单链表中存在环呢?先创造一下带环的单链表: 代码如下: 创建带环单链表: 结果可见: 判断单链表是否带环,以下有三种方法:第一种方法, 创建哈希表,不过会占用较大的空间,不是最佳方...
...我它是否存在其中(尽量高效)。 需求其实很清晰,只是要判断一个数据是否存在即可。 但这里有一个比较重要的前提:非常庞大的数据。 常规实现 先不考虑这个条件,我们脑海中出现的第一种方案是什么? 我想大多数想到的...
如果是下面的 jQuery 代码判断一个对象是否存在,是不能用的。 if($(#id)){ //... }else{ //... } 因为$(#id)不管对象是否存在都会返回 object 。 正确使用判断对象是否存在应该用: if($(#id).length>0){ //... }else{ //... } ...
...ecoratorFactory 函数内部定义 decorator 函数,当调用时,会先判断当前的调用方式,如果是 @decorator 方式调用,则直接执行 decorator 函数,否则返回 decorator 函数。 decorator 函数内部会首先判断构造函数的原型对象上是否存在 __mobxDecor...
...照原策略继续比较 virtual DOM tree。 如果不是,则将该组件判断为 dirty component,从而替换整个组件下的所有子节点。 对于同一类型的组件,有可能其 Virtual DOM 没有任何变化,如果能够确切的知道这点那可以节省大量的 diff 运算时...
... void addEntry(int hash, K key, V value, int bucketIndex) { // 判断散列表是否需要扩容或者未初始化 if ((size >= threshold) && (null != table[bucketIndex])) { // 散列表扩容为原来的2倍 ...
package com.itheima.demo01.File; import java.io.File; /* File类判断功能的方法 - public boolean exists() :此File表示的文件或目录是否实际存在。 - public boolean isDirectory() :此File表示的是否为目录。 - public boolean isFile...
...然而源数据只可以形成 3 种组合 这种情况下最好能提前判断出来不可选的路径并置灰,告诉用户,否则会造成误解 确定规则 看下图,如果我们定义红色为当前选中的商品的属性,即当前选中商品为 红-大-A,这个时候如何确认...
...到这种代码: 变量与null的比较(这种用法很有问题), 用来判断变量是否被赋予了一个合理的值. 比如: const Controller = { process(items) { if(!items !== null) { // 不好的写法 items.sort(); items.forEach(item => { ...
JavaScript专题系列第五篇,讲解更加复杂的类型判断,比如 plainObject、空对象、类数组对象、Window对象、DOM 元素等 前言 在上篇《JavaScript专题之类型判断(上)》中,我们抄袭 jQuery 写了一个 type 函数,可以检测出常见的数据类...
...Profile(Bob, address); 遇到问题: 一开始把firstName和prop的判断写在了一个for循环下,结果导致如果firstName不是在第一个object中,则直接返回No such contact,不再继续查找数组。 解决方法: 先将所有firstName存入一个数组,判断first...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...